diff --git a/vscode-extensions/vscode-concourse/icon-white.svg b/vscode-extensions/vscode-concourse/icon-white.svg new file mode 100644 index 0000000000..31baacd8e3 --- /dev/null +++ b/vscode-extensions/vscode-concourse/icon-white.svg @@ -0,0 +1,17 @@ + + + + Concourse_logo_white + Created with Sketch. + + + + + + + + + + + + \ No newline at end of file diff --git a/vscode-extensions/vscode-concourse/package.json b/vscode-extensions/vscode-concourse/package.json index 6896acd2da..60e3b6b547 100644 --- a/vscode-extensions/vscode-concourse/package.json +++ b/vscode-extensions/vscode-concourse/package.json @@ -73,7 +73,11 @@ "**/pipeline/*.yml" ], "firstLine": "^#(\\s)*pipeline(\\s)*", - "configuration": "./yaml-support/language-configuration.json" + "configuration": "./yaml-support/language-configuration.json", + "icon": { + "light": "./icon.png", + "dark": "./icon-white.svg" + } }, { "id": "concourse-task-yaml", @@ -87,7 +91,11 @@ "**/concourse/**/tasks/*.yml" ], "firstLine": "^#(\\s)*task(\\s)*", - "configuration": "./yaml-support/language-configuration.json" + "configuration": "./yaml-support/language-configuration.json", + "icon": { + "light": "./icon.png", + "dark": "./icon-white.svg" + } } ], "grammars": [